3 submission types are available:
1. Regular Abstract Submission
Researchers and professionals are encouraged to submit abstracts highlighting their work in the field of polyphenols & their applications. Abstracts should provide a concise summary of the research objectives, methods, key findings, and their implications in future research. Accepted abstracts will be presented as posters or oral presentations during the conference sessions, allowing participants to showcase their work and engage in fruitful discussions.

2. Project Proposals
In addition to abstract submissions, the conference welcomes project proposals that showcase innovative applications, technologies, or initiatives related to polyphenols. These proposals should outline the project’s objectives, methodologies, expected outcomes, and potential impact in the field. Accepted project proposals may have the opportunity to be featured in dedicated sessions or workshops during the conference, providing a platform to discuss and collaborate with other participants.
Deadline for Project Proposal Submission: September 12, 2023.
